Sydney-based DJ/vocalist Anna Lunoe is a busy young woman. She's DJed with the likes of The Chemical Brothers, Daft Punk and Lupe Fiasco, provided musical direction for Louis Vuiton and Hugo Boss, and put on numerous club events with her DJ Crew - Hoops. Sydney Magazine also named her among their 100 most influential people list in 2010.
She's just released an EP, Real Talk, on which she's enlisted a number of musical friends. The standout single is "I Met You," her collaboration with up-and-coming Sydney producer Flume, who rose to prominence after being uncovered during FBI's Northern Lights Competition in 2011.
"I Met You" is typical of both Lunoe and Flume, well-produced and smooth. Known more from her DJ work, Lunoe's vocals are a welcome surprise, while Flume provides his characteristic groove-laden flows and staggered-cuts. This is definitely one for summer.
